Variables Influencing Surety Performance Bond Prices



You need to take into consideration several aspects that can affect the expense of surety efficiency bonds for your organization.

The initial variable is the bond amount. Normally, the higher the bond amount, the higher the price of the bond.

Another element is the economic standing of your company. If your company has a strong financial track record and great credit history, you might be able to safeguard a lower bond price.

In addition, the kind of job or agreement can influence the bond expense. Higher-risk projects may call for a greater bond costs.

Reviewing the Risk Account for Bond Rates



When reviewing the threat profile for bond pricing, take into consideration elements such as the job's intricacy and the contractor's experience. These two factors play a crucial role in figuring out the level of risk related to the task and, consequently, the price of the efficiency bond.

A complicated task with elaborate design demands and tight deadlines presents a higher risk for the surety firm. Similarly, a service provider with minimal experience in managing comparable tasks might be considered greater risk as well.

Other factors that may affect bond rates include the economic security of the contractor, the job's place, and the schedule of subcontractors.
